Frequently Asked Questions

What is the property tax difference between Arapahoe County and Deschutes County?
Arapahoe County, CO has an effective property tax rate of 0.56% with a median annual tax of $4,031. Deschutes County, OR has a rate of 0.91% with a median annual tax of $2,409. The difference is 0.35 percentage points.
Which county has higher property taxes, Arapahoe County or Deschutes County?
Deschutes County, OR has the higher effective property tax rate at 0.91% compared to 0.56%.
How do Arapahoe County and Deschutes County compare to the national average?
The national average effective property tax rate is 1.06%. Arapahoe County is below average at 0.56%, and Deschutes County is below average at 0.91%.
